Abstract

RAMOS, Liz Angélica; BUSTOS PINZON, Alex Francisco; MELGAREJO R, Miguel A  and  VARGAS DOMINGUEZ, Santiago. Fuzzy Inference Systems Tuning with Optimization Algorithms for Solar Flares Classification. Tecciencia [online]. 2017, vol.12, n.23, pp.33-42. ISSN 1909-3667.  https://doi.org/10.18180/tecciencia.2017.23.5.

In this work we describe the implementation and analysis of different optimization algorithms used for finding the best set of parameters for a Fuzzy Inference System intended to classify solar flares. The parameters will be identified among a universe of possible solutions for the algorithms, and the system will be tested in the particular case of dealing with the aim of classifying the solar flares.

Keywords : ANFIS; EBDF; Solar Flares; Fuzzy Sets.
